LaCo2Si2 is an intermetallic compound composed of lanthanum, cobalt, and silicon, belonging to the rare-earth transition metal silicide family. This material is primarily investigated in research contexts for potential applications in high-temperature structural applications and magnetic device engineering, where the combination of rare-earth and transition metal elements can offer unique thermal stability and electromagnetic properties. Engineers would consider this compound for advanced applications requiring lightweight intermetallic phases or as a constituent in composite systems, though it remains largely in the experimental phase rather than established commercial production.
